Common Welding Certifications

While the AWS’ regular CW (Certified Welder) certification helps make you eligible for almost all employment opportunities, some fields mandate their certain certificate. A handful of the most-popular of them are highlighted below.

  • ASME Certification for those that focus on boiler and pressure containers
  • Certified Welder Certificates to be a Certified Welder
  • API Certification for those who work with pipelines in the oil and gas industry
  • SCWI and CWI Certification for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ors

The subsequent table illustrates wages and labor forecasts for professional welders in the State of Wyoming through 2022.

Wyoming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 2,440 2,730 12% 90
Wyoming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$30,700 $46,100 $73,300

Source: O*Net Online

Information on Welding Specialist Training in Arrowhead Springs, WY

Picking out which classes to sign-up for is generally a personal decision, but here are several points you should be mindful of prior to deciding on certified welding schools. Once you start looking around, you will discover lots of courses, but what exactly do you have to look for when deciding on brazing classes? Remember to determine if the training programs have been accepted either by a national agency like the AWS. A number of other topics that you may want to check out besides the accreditation issue are:

  • Look for institutions that fulfill AWS SENSE standards
  • Make certain the institution trains with technology that suits up-to-date field specifications
  • Determine if the college gives financial support
  • Make certain the school’s program provides you with courses in GTAW, SMAW, pipe welding and GMAW
